A tire company wants to determine if tires made with a
new type of tread will last longer than tires made with
the original type of tread. The company has access to
24 different vehicles. Each vehicle will receive four tires
with the new tread and four with the original tread. The
position, front or back, will be randomly determined for
a pair of each type of tread. For example, a vehicle will
have the new type of tread on the front tires and the
original tread on the back tires. After six months, the
pairs of unused tires will be used with the position
switched on the car. The vehicles will be driven for six
more months. At the end of one year, the depths of the
remaining tread will be measured for each fire and the
average differences between the new and original
tread types will be determined. The average
differences will then be used to determine if the new
tread does last longer.


Is this a matched pairs design for this experiment?
